Colorful creativity draws inspiration from a kaleidoscope of sources, igniting unique and vibrant ideas that manifest in expressive works of art, design, and writing. Exploring these sources unveils the boundless potential of color to inspire and enhance the creative process.

Nature’s Vibrant Hues and Patterns

Nature’s symphony of colors, from the emerald hues of lush forests to the golden glow of sunsets, provides a rich tapestry of inspiration. The intricate patterns found in flowers, animal markings, and geological formations offer endless possibilities for color combinations and designs.

Example: The renowned painter Vincent van Gogh drew inspiration from the vibrant colors and patterns of the natural world, creating masterpieces like “Starry Night” and “Sunflowers.”

Cultural Traditions and Festivals

Cultural traditions and festivals around the globe are a vibrant celebration of color. From the colorful costumes of Indian Holi to the intricate decorations of Chinese New Year, these events showcase the power of color to convey cultural identity and evoke emotions.

Example: The Mexican artist Frida Kahlo incorporated the vibrant colors and traditional motifs of her Mexican heritage into her self-portraits, expressing her cultural identity and personal experiences.

Art and Design Movements

Throughout history, art and design movements have embraced color as a central element. From the bold hues of Impressionism to the minimalist color palettes of Modernism, these movements demonstrate the transformative power of color in shaping artistic expression.

Example: The Bauhaus movement emphasized the use of primary colors and geometric shapes, influencing everything from architecture to graphic design.

Personal Experiences and Emotions

Our own personal experiences and emotions can serve as a profound source of inspiration for colorful creativity. Colors can evoke memories, symbolize feelings, and express our inner worlds.

Example: The abstract expressionist artist Mark Rothko explored the emotional impact of color through his large-scale color field paintings, inviting viewers to experience the raw power of color.

Mind Mapping

  • Mind mapping involves creating a visual representation of ideas and concepts by connecting them through branches and sub-branches.
  • It allows for brainstorming, problem-solving, and organizing thoughts in a non-linear and intuitive way.
  • By creating a visual map of ideas, individuals can explore connections, identify patterns, and generate new perspectives.

Freewriting

  • Freewriting is a technique that involves writing without any inhibitions or judgment.
  • It encourages individuals to let their thoughts flow freely onto paper, without worrying about grammar or structure.
  • By engaging in freewriting, individuals can access their subconscious mind and generate ideas that may not have been consciously considered.

Sensory Exploration

  • Sensory exploration involves engaging the senses to stimulate creativity.
  • This can be done through activities such as drawing, painting, listening to music, or exploring different textures and scents.
  • By engaging the senses, individuals can access new perspectives and generate ideas that are inspired by their surroundings.

Collaborative Brainstorming

  • Collaborative brainstorming involves working with others to generate ideas and solutions.
  • It allows individuals to share perspectives, build upon each other’s ideas, and challenge assumptions.
  • By collaborating with others, individuals can gain new insights and develop more innovative and diverse ideas.

Successful Initiatives and Programs

  • The Imagination Project:A non-profit organization that provides arts-based education programs to underprivileged students, fostering their creativity and self-expression.
  • Project Zero:A research and development center at Harvard University that promotes creative thinking in schools through the “Thinking Routines” framework.
